v6 v7 11 11 == C17.00 == 12 12 13 When using fork-based parallelization (on nearly all systems this is the default) '''''the output from the SAVE XSPEC command will be faulty'''''. The workaround is to use either MPI_based parallelization, or do a sequential run by using the SEQUENTIAL keyword on the GRID command. 14 13 15 The inward component of the emergent line predictions was inadvertently left out, as reported on the Cloudy user group. This is not a widely used part of the code predictions and it will be fixed in the next major release. 14 16 15 Some of our line labels have more than four characters. Long labels must be entered in double quotes in line lists, as in {{{"O 3c"}}}.
